We are running puppet (3.7.x) on Windows daemonized. We recently turned on splay because reasons. After having done so the interval between daemonised runs, counter to expectation, has become randomised (though we get an averageish run interval of 30 minutes (30.5 recurring)). The linuxes here have identical config and their runs are as regular as a muesli eating vegetarian. Here are some report times and approximate delta of a representative Windows 2012:
